Dielectric and electret properties of bismuth titanate ferroelectric ceramics with compensated conductivity

Abstract

The introduction of tungsten and niobium oxides into pure bismuth titanate allows one to reduce dielectric losses and the conductivity down to 10−10 S/m, to raise the permittivity up to 170, and to stabilize piezoelectric properties. The thermos lectret state becomes stable - in 6 years after polarization the surface density of the charge was 26 μC/m2.
